In 2026, selecting the right color corrector for under-eye circles requires understanding your specific discoloration. Different hues target particular issues: peach and orange combat blue or purple shadows, yellow neutralizes dullness, green offsets redness, and lavender or pink counteracts fatigue. Corrector Shades for Tones
Choosing the right corrector shade is important for covering dark circles under your eyes. Different colors fix different problems. For example, orange or peach correctors work well on blue or purple circles. Yellow correctors make dull skin look brighter and hide blue or purple spots, especially on lighter skin. Green correctors cancel out redness, like broken blood vessels or skin irritation. Pink and lavender shades help wake up tired-looking skin, mainly on medium to dark skin tones.
It’s important to pick the correct shade for your skin. If you choose the wrong one, it can make the problem stand out more. Knowing your discoloration’s tone helps you find the right color. This makes your makeup look better and more natural.

Skin Type Compatibility
Your skin type is important when choosing a color corrector for dark circles. Different formulas work better for different skin types.
If you have oily skin, pick a matte, oil-free corrector. This helps prevent creasing and keeps it on longer.
For dry or sensitive skin, look for products with hydrating ingredients like hyaluronic acid or shea butter. These help keep your skin moist and calm any irritation.
If your skin is mature, choose light and dewy formulas. These won’t settle into fine lines or make wrinkles look more obvious.
It’s also a good idea to test the corrector on a small patch of skin first. This helps you see if it causes any reaction or irritation.

Application Techniques
To use color correctors well, you need to pay attention to how you place and blend them. Use a small, dense brush or your clean fingertip to put the corrector exactly on the dark spots under your eyes. Gently tap and blend the edges into your skin. This makes the correction look natural and smooth. Apply in thin layers rather than thick piles. This helps prevent creases and a cakey look. After placing the corrector, use a damp makeup sponge or brush to blend it further. This makes the finish smooth and helps the product last longer. Once you finish, set the area with a light, translucent powder. This keeps the corrector in place and stops it from creasing. Good technique makes your makeup look natural and last longer.

Compatibility With Foundation
To make your color corrector work well with your foundation, start by checking their formulas. Some correctors are liquids, creams, or powders. Pick the type that matches your foundation. For example, if your foundation is liquid, a liquid corrector will blend better.
Test the corrector on a small patch of your skin. Put it next to your foundation to see if they look good together. Check for any separation or uneven coverage. Do this before using both on your whole face.
If you want a dewy or shiny finish, choose a lightweight, hydrating corrector. This keeps your face from looking cakey. Also, think about the finish of your foundation. Matte correctors go well with matte foundations. Luminous correctors match dewy or shiny foundations.
Be careful about mixing oil-based correctors with water-based foundations. They don’t blend well and can create patches or uneven color. Choose products that match in texture and finish for a seamless look.
Making sure your corrector and foundation work together helps your makeup look natural and smooth.

Which Color Corrector Works Best for Blue Under-Eye Circles?
You should use an orange or peach color corrector, as it neutralizes the blue tones of your under-eye circles. Apply gently before concealer, and blend well for a natural look that brightens and evens your skin tone effectively.
